A 4ft flat sheet, often referred to as a full-size flat sheet, is a fundamental bedding item that adds comfort and style to your sleep experience. Measuring approximately 54 inches by 75 inches, it is specifically designed to fit a standard full-sized mattress, providing ample coverage for a restful night's sleep.
While bed linen and bed sheets are often used interchangeably, they are actually two distinct types of bedding that serve different purposes. Bed sheets are the primary layer that goes directly on top of the mattress, while bed linen encompasses a range of additional bedding items such as duvet covers, pillowcases, and decorative blankets. Bed linen described as 'luxe' or 'hotel quality' is not necessarily made from Egyptian cotton. Look for the symbol of Egyptian cotton authenticity on the care label or packaging.
Thread count refers to the number of threads woven into one square inch of fabric, both horizontally and vertically. Typically, the higher the thread count, the smoother and more durable the sheet. Another great feature of waffle robes is their absorbent and quick-drying properties. The waffle texture of the fabric helps to wick away moisture, making them perfect for wearing after a shower or bath. The quick-drying nature of waffle robes also means that you can easily throw them on over your swimwear at the beach or pool, and they will dry in no time.
